Action item from the Scholaris timetable solver incident (double-booked classrooms during the autumn rollout): the release manager must verify the constraint-validation suite passes against the full Northgate district dataset before tagging any solver release. A dry-run against last term's timetable is now mandatory, and the results must be attached to the release ticket. The dry-run procedure is documented on the internal release page.

operations page: https://jenkins.zemvarcloud.local/job/merge_requests/repo/build/73930b4b30f0a8ed

As part of the Quillbase migration off the legacy Herondale ORM, we changed several connection-pool defaults that were previously inherited from the old adapter. Lazy loading is now disabled by default, and the session flush mode switched from auto to commit, which eliminates the phantom-write bug reported by the Tarviston team. Reviewers should pay close attention to the transaction boundary changes in `repository/base.py`, since they alter retry semantics. The full set of updated defaults is listed below for reference.

config for haweg-bagag:
[kasath]
host = kasath.qirvancorp.internal
user = kasath_svc
database = kasath_prod

## Deploying the Gatewick Proctor Queue

Deploys are pretty painless: push to main, wait for the pipeline, then watch the queue drain dashboard for five minutes. If candidates pile up mid-exam, roll back first and ask questions later — the queue replays safely. Everything the workers care about lives in one config block, shown here for reference.

settings of bafof-yagef:
JOROX_PIN=8740
JOROX_TENANT=pelox
JOROX_METRICS_HOST=metrics.jorox.qorvelworks.internal
JOROX_SEAL=seal_c78f63c1
JOROX_STANDBY_TEAM=norax

Ticket: Config drift on finish-line chip reader (Harrowfell Marathon)

The Tamsen RFID reader at the finish gantry is reporting different antenna gain and poll intervals than the reader at the 10k split, even though both should run the baseline profile. Someone hand-edited the finish unit during last month's event and never synced it back. Please audit the unit against the baseline and restore it. The expected baseline configuration is listed below.

config for kafof-bawef:
holath:
  log_level: debug
  metrics_host: metrics.holath.qorvelsys.internal
  pin: 2191
  pool_size: 32